Bachelor of Materials Engineering
Program Educational Objectives (PEOs)
Providing a top-tier applied and technical education in materials engineering, emphasizing theoretical foundations and hands-on practical skills.
Fostering an environment within the Materials Engineering Department that encourages innovation and creativity, empowering students to think critically and develop novel solutions to real-world challenges.
Engaging in cutting-edge research activities to contribute to the advancement of materials science and engineering, with a focus on developing new materials and technologies.
Equipping students with the skills, knowledge, and ethical values necessary to emerge as leaders in the field of materials engineering, promoting a commitment to professionalism and social responsibility.
Aligning with the broader university mission, the Materials Engineering Department aims to play a key role in achieving sustainable development and contributing to the knowledge economy through its educational and research initiatives.
Program Learning Outcomes (PLOs):
The department links the targeted learning outcomes of the program directly with the results and objectives of the courses taught within the curriculum of the Materials Engineering program at Al-Balqa Applied University. These outcomes include the following:
An ability to identify, formulate, and solve complex engineering problems by applying principles of engineering, science, and mathematics.
An ability to apply engineering design to produce solutions that meet specified needs with considerations of public health, safety, and welfare as well as global, cultural, social, environmental, and economic factors.
An ability to communicate effectively with a range of audiences.
An ability to recognize ethical and professional responsibilities in engineering situations and make informed judgments, which must consider the impact of engineering solutions in global, economic, environmental, and social contexts.
An ability to function effectively on a team whose members together provide leadership, create a collaborative and inclusive environment, establish goals, plan tasks, and meet objectives.
An ability to develop and conduct appropriate experimentation, analyze and interpret data, and use engineering judgment to draw conclusions.
An ability to acquire and apply new knowledge as needed, using appropriate learning strategies.
